Advanced Pre-Treatment Technology: The foundation of a durable coating is proper surface preparation. Our line features a multi-stage pre-treatment system, typically including degreasing, rinsing, phosphating or chromating, and final rinsing. This process effectively removes oils, rust, and contaminants, creating a chemically active surface that significantly enhances powder adhesion and corrosion resistance, which is critical for motor parts operating in harsh environments.
High-Efficiency Powder Application: At the heart of the line is our advanced powder application booth. Utilizing electrostatic spray guns, either manual or automatic, it ensures a uniform and controlled deposition of powder onto the parts. The booth is designed with high-efficiency cartridge filters and a powder recovery system, reclaiming over 95% of oversprayed powder. This dramatically reduces material waste and operational costs while maintaining a clean working environment.
Precision Curing Oven: The curing stage is where the powder transforms into a continuous, protective film. Our oven provides precise temperature and time control, with even heat distribution across the entire curing zone. This is vital for achieving the full mechanical and chemical properties of the powder, such as impact resistance, flexibility, and long-term weatherability. Options include electric, gas, or infrared heating to suit different energy availability and part geometries.
Robust Conveyor System: A reliable conveyor system transports parts through each stage without interruption. We offer various types, such as overhead chain, monorail, or belt conveyors, selected based on the weight, size, and shape of your motor parts. The system is built for heavy-duty use, ensuring minimal downtime and consistent line speed, which is crucial for maintaining production schedules.
Intelligent PLC Control: The entire line is managed by a centralized Programmable Logic Controller (PLC) with a user-friendly touch-screen Human-Machine Interface (HMI). Operators can easily monitor all parameters—temperatures, conveyor speed, spray gun settings—and make adjustments as needed. This level of automation ensures repeatable quality, simplifies operation, and provides valuable data for process optimization and troubleshooting.
The technical specifications of the line can be customized to match your specific production volume and part requirements. Below is a reference table outlining common configurations:
| Parameter | Specification / Option |
|---|---|
| Typical Line Length | 20 - 80 meters (customizable) |
| Conveyor Speed Range | 0.5 - 3.0 meters per minute |
| Pre-treatment Stages | 6-8 stages (spray or immersion) |
| Curing Oven Temperature Range | 150°C - 220°C (adjustable) |
| Powder Recovery Efficiency | > 95% |
| Control System | PLC with Touch Screen HMI |
| Power Supply | 380V/50Hz or as per local standards |

Powder coating provides a thicker, more uniform layer without runs or sags, offering superior dielectric strength and insulation resistance. It also provides excellent corrosion protection and mechanical durability, which is crucial for parts that may experience vibration, moisture, or temperature fluctuations.Can the line handle different colors or powder types without extensive downtime for changeover?
